Investigators from the Meridian Fire Department have not yet determined the cause of a house fire late Thursday night but the home's owner believes he knows what happened.
Johnny Jordan's one-story house at 29th Avenue and Second Street sustained heavy damage to the bathroom and bedroom.
The fire started about 10:50 p.m. as he was preparing for bed. Jordan, 42, was not injured.
Battalion Chief Howard Gibson listed the cause as "undetermined" in his report, but said the fire started in a bathroom in the back of the house.
Four MFD units two engines, a ladder truck and a rescue truck responded to the scene and extinguished the blaze.
Jordan said he was watching television in the living room when he sensed something was wrong. He went to a neighbor's house to call 911.
